Q: Is 152,521,303 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 152,521,303 is a composite number.

Why is 152,521,303 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 152,521,303 can be evenly divided by 1 11 19 23 209 253 437 4,807 31,729 349,019 602,851 729,767 6,631,361 8,027,437 13,865,573 and 152,521,303, with no remainder.

Since 152,521,303 cannot be divided by just 1 and 152,521,303, it is a composite number.
